Noma proved that fine dining did not have to mimic classic French techniques. By looking strictly at their own geography, Redzepi and his staff created a brand-new culinary language that inspired restaurants globally to focus on hyper-local sourcing. In the world of haute cuisine, few names carry as much weight as Noma. Located in Copenhagen, Denmark, this culinary powerhouse completely redefined global gastronomy. The 2015 documentary Noma: My Perfect Storm , directed by Pierre Deschamps, offers an intimate look into the mind of its creative force, Chef René Redzepi.
